Transaction

8d4676ef2d066a8d198d6fb83c78b4d1a18b39698454bb588240d82bb1cd17e0

Summary

In Block466636
TimeSat, 02 Dec 2023 11:38:45 UTC
Total Input883.2498054 Nebula
Total Output917.2498054 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
228376 Confirmations917.2498054 Nebula
Raw Transaction